接着,是创建本地源,在/mnt目录下新建一个名为repo的目录,把ISO中的CentOS目录下所有的rpm软件包建立链接到/mnt/repo目录下;打开终端输入命令createrepo /mnt/repo系统会自动在/mnt/repo目录下建立一个repodate目录并在该目录下生成四个文件,这步需要较长时间,操作如下:
# mkdir /mnt/repo/
# cd /mnt/repo/
# ln -s ../iso/CentOS/* ./
# createrepo /mnt/repo/
然后,把/etc/yum.repos.d/里的所有文件移动到别一个目录,如下:
# mkdir /root/backup/
# mv /etc/yum.repos.d/* /root/backup/
最后,在/etc/yum.repos.d/目录下新建一个CDROM.repo文本文件,如下:
# gedit /etc/yum.repos.d/CDROM.repo
内容如下:
[local]
name=iso for local software
baseurl=file:///mnt/iso
gpgcheck=0
[repo]
name=iso2 for local software
baseurl=file:///mnt/repo
enabled=1
gpgcheck=0
保存后退出,就可以进行添加/删除软件操作了。我是默认安装的CentOS5系统,现在把“开发工具”添加上吧!
